I recently struggled through a workshop having lost my pastels along with my luggage. I had to buy Windsor and Newton pastels as replacements. The difference was incredible. They were unforgiving, scratchy and gave a very 'thin' result.
Unison also make fantastic darks, which I find are virtually ignored by other manufacturers. I love their flow, not quite as soft as Sennelier.
Re paper; have you tried Kitty Wallis paper, very popular in the US and will take wet media as well. It's a bit more expensive but high quality
